Transaction 57cc0822b986eb93eb58c7716b47bbfd91f020b39b22196a4024fcbd78652aa8
1 Input
1 Output
-
57cc0822b986eb93eb58c7716b47bbfd91f020b39b22196a4024fcbd78652aa8:0
- value
- 399755
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8e991e596bc5a392b60f34735e40a45abefe2fc OP_EQUAL
- address
- 3JYk4Za55syw4MN15npta6pjJqyhBnbyVN